The FMVs were clearly drawing from the look of the movie, as were the harvesters in the later games (Dune II just had big, boxy ones instead of the beetle-like harvesters from the movie; Dune II in general was less true to the source material in general). There are also the sound-based weapons like the Atreides sonic tanks, which are taken from the weirding modules from the Lynch movie. If I remember right, David Lynch thought it would look bad having the Fremen beat the Harkonnens and the Sardaukar by doing martial arts moves out in the desert. Warfare in the movie had less emphasis on the hand-to-hand combat than the books, which from what I remember featured bladed weapons and shields but with technology like lasguns too. Dune 2000 departed even further from the books by having so many units armed with standard gun weapons (Emperor even retconned "kindjals" into being mortars and not knives), which might be inspired by the movie scene of Duncan's death where a Sardaukar's bullet is shown penetrating his shield. Speaking of which, the appearance of the Sardaukar troops in Dune 2000 and Emperor: Battle for Dune is clearly based on the hazmat-style suits they wore in the Lynch movie.

One thing which wasn't based on the movie was the Ordos faction. They were inspired by Willis McNelly's Dune Encyclopedia, which was basically officially approved fanfiction.
